Major U.S. banks are no longer watching crypto payment rails from the sidelines. They are building their own version of the rails.
That is the practical read from reports that JPMorgan, Bank of America, Citi and other large U.S. banks are developing a shared tokenized deposit network. CoinDesk framed the project as a bank response to the stablecoin threat. The Block, citing the Wall Street Journal, reported that a JPMorgan- and Citi-backed consortium plans to launch a tokenized deposit network in early 2027.
For crypto investors, this is bigger than another “banks are using blockchain” headline. It is a sign that the payment-rail debate is moving from slogans to architecture. Banks want faster settlement, programmable money movement and better cross-border plumbing. But they also want deposits, compliance, customer relationships and balance-sheet control to remain inside the regulated banking system.
That creates a sharper test for XRP, XLM, XDC, HBAR, ALGO, VeChain and the broader group of infrastructure tokens often placed under the ISO 20022 or “new financial system” banner. The question is not whether banks will use digital settlement technology. That part is becoming less controversial. The question is whether public-network tokens become part of actual institutional workflows, or whether banks build tokenized versions of existing money and keep most settlement inside permissioned networks.
The Bank Version of Tokenization Looks Different
Tokenized deposits are not the same thing as public crypto assets.
A tokenized deposit is generally a digital representation of a bank deposit, issued by a regulated bank and designed to move on digital rails. The asset still points back to a bank liability. That matters because commercial banks already sit at the center of money movement for businesses, consumers and institutions. If they can make deposits more programmable and faster to settle, they can answer part of the stablecoin pitch without giving up the deposit franchise.
That is why this reported bank network matters. Stablecoins have been gaining attention because they can move value continuously, across borders and outside normal banking hours. Ripple’s own stablecoin payments commentary says global stablecoin transaction volume hit $33 trillion in 2025, larger than global credit card volume. The point is not that every dollar of that volume equals productive commerce. The point is that stablecoins have demonstrated demand for faster, more flexible settlement rails.
Banks see that. They also see the risk of losing payment flow, treasury relationships and settlement economics to non-bank issuers. A shared tokenized deposit network is a defensive move, but it is also an adoption signal. The largest banks are effectively saying that digital money movement is no longer a science project.
Why This Matters for XRP, XLM, XDC, HBAR, ALGO and VeChain
Payment-rail tokens need to be evaluated by where they can actually sit in the stack.
XRP has long been tied to cross-border payment narratives. XLM is usually discussed around remittances and lower-cost value transfer. XDC is often framed around trade finance and enterprise settlement. HBAR, ALGO and VeChain each carry different infrastructure pitches around speed, enterprise use, data integrity, supply chains or tokenized assets.
But bank tokenized deposits force a more disciplined question: what problem does the token solve that a bank-issued digital deposit does not?
There are possible answers. Public or hybrid networks may still matter for interoperability, liquidity bridging, asset issuance, cross-border corridors, auditability, settlement outside single-bank networks and access for fintechs that are not part of a closed consortium. Some tokens may also support applications around trade documentation, supply-chain finance, tokenized collateral or machine-readable compliance.
But the answer cannot just be “ISO 20022.” Messaging compatibility is not adoption. A payment standard does not create demand for a token by itself. Banks adopt workflows that reduce cost, manage risk, satisfy regulators and integrate with their existing systems. If a token does not help with one of those, the branding does not matter.
This is where crypto’s payment-rail sector has to get more practical. The winning infrastructure will not be the chain with the loudest community. It will be the one that can answer treasury-desk questions: who holds the asset, what is the settlement finality, what happens on a failed transaction, how is compliance handled, what is the liquidity source, what balance-sheet exposure exists, and who is accountable when something breaks?
Stablecoins Forced the Issue
The bank move also shows that stablecoins did their job as a competitive pressure.
Ripple’s fintech stablecoin checklist makes a useful point: stablecoins can simplify value movement and settlement, but they shift complexity into compliance, treasury and daily operations. That is exactly where banks believe they have an advantage. They already run compliance departments, manage treasury operations and maintain customer relationships. If they can add faster digital settlement without moving customers into third-party stablecoins, they have a credible counteroffer.
That does not mean stablecoins lose. It means the market is splitting.
Stablecoins may continue to dominate crypto-native markets, global dollar access, fintech corridors and regions where banking rails are slow or fragmented. Tokenized deposits may become more attractive for regulated institutions that want digital settlement but prefer bank liabilities over issuer-managed stablecoins. Public-network tokens may find their role where interoperability, cross-network liquidity or specialized infrastructure is needed.
The mistake is treating all of these as one fight. They are different instruments for different workflows.
A U.S. corporation moving funds between major banks may prefer tokenized deposits if the network is reliable and accepted by its banking partners. A fintech serving cross-border users may prefer stablecoins if they provide broader reach and continuous settlement. A trade-finance platform may need tokenized documents, collateral tracking and payment coordination across multiple parties. Those are separate use cases, and they will not all be won by one token or one network.
The Cross-Border Angle Is Still Open
The most interesting opening for payment-rail tokens remains cross-border settlement.
Domestic U.S. bank settlement is hard to penetrate because large banks have existing relationships, regulatory clarity and strong incentives to keep activity inside bank-controlled infrastructure. Cross-border payments are messier. Different currencies, banking hours, correspondent relationships, compliance regimes and local liquidity constraints create friction.
That is where XRP, XLM, XDC and similar payment-focused networks have historically made their case. The question now is whether they can connect to the next generation of bank and fintech infrastructure, not just pitch against legacy rails.
If tokenized deposits stay mostly domestic or consortium-based, there may still be a need for bridges between bank networks, stablecoin networks and local payment systems. But bridges have to be trusted. They have to survive compliance review. They have to offer liquidity without creating unacceptable volatility or counterparty risk.
That is a high bar, but it is also a real market. Ripple’s broader payments commentary says institutions are operating across multiple stablecoins and local-currency assets because different corridors and counterparties require different tools. That kind of multi-asset environment could leave room for neutral settlement infrastructure. It could also make life harder for any token that depends on a single grand narrative.
Tokenized Capital Markets Add Another Layer
Payments are only one side of the story. Tokenized funds, onchain repo markets, digital collateral and real-time settlement are also moving into mainstream finance discussions. Ripple’s UK capital markets commentary describes a market where blockchain adoption is being driven increasingly by large institutions, not only crypto-native firms.
That matters for altcoins because payment rails may eventually connect to capital-market rails. If funds, collateral and deposits become tokenized, settlement infrastructure becomes more than moving money from A to B. It becomes the coordination layer between assets, cash, margin, compliance and reporting.
HBAR, ALGO, XDC and VeChain-style infrastructure stories often live in this broader enterprise bucket. The opportunity is not simply “banks use blockchain.” The opportunity is whether a network can support reliable business processes across many parties that do not fully trust each other but still need shared records and settlement.
Again, the practical test is integration. Enterprises do not adopt infrastructure because crypto holders want validation. They adopt it when the system lowers reconciliation costs, reduces settlement delay, improves audit trails or unlocks a workflow that was previously too expensive to run.
The Investor Takeaway
The reported U.S. bank tokenized deposit network is not automatically bullish or bearish for payment-rail tokens. It is clarifying.
It confirms that digital settlement is becoming part of mainstream financial infrastructure. That supports the long-term thesis behind many altcoin payment and enterprise networks. But it also shows that banks are not waiting for public tokens to define the future. They are building bank-native rails that preserve regulated deposits and institutional control.
For XRP, XLM, XDC, HBAR, ALGO, VeChain and similar assets, the bar is moving higher. The market will care less about broad “new financial system” claims and more about specific roles: cross-border liquidity, interoperability, tokenized collateral, trade finance, compliance-aware settlement, enterprise data integrity or access to corridors bank networks do not serve well.
That is a healthier standard. It separates infrastructure from branding. It also means investors should be careful with any claim that a bank tokenization move automatically validates a specific token. Adoption has to show up in workflows, not just in language that sounds adjacent.
The next financial system is likely to be mixed: bank tokenized deposits, regulated stablecoins, public networks, private networks and old rails that refuse to disappear quickly. The winners will be the assets and platforms that can plug into that reality without pretending they own all of it.
